    ganito ba sir?

    torx-head.jpg

    e di ganito need mo

    torx-bit.jpg

    TORX ang tawag dyan. yung iba pa may pin sa gitna lalo na yung mga made in France na appliances.

    torx-head-pin.jpg

    so need mo Torx driver na may butas

    torx-driver-hole.jpg

    meron nyan sa handyman at ace, green ang color. yung ordinary hex bit red ang color.
